ANNOUNCEMENT

According to the legislation of the Republic of Armenia each shareholder of H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c has the right to receive the copies of the latest annual report, external auditor’s report, as well as the information stipulated in subsections 4 and 5 of article 43 of the RA Law on Banks and Banking Activity. The Law can be found at the following address:
www.cba.am/AM/lalaws/orenq2.pdf.

The abovementioned information will be provided FREE of charge within three business days after the receipt of a written request from the shareholder. The written request can be submitted to Bank’s Head Office or any branch as well as via hsbc.armenia@hsbc.com e-mail address.

Board of Directors and Managers of H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c

Watche Manoukian, Board Chairman, (Date of birth - 1945)
A founding shareholder of H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c, appointed Chairman of the Board in 1995. A London-based investor, commercial developer and philanthropist of international repute. Member of Board of Trustees of Hayastan All Armenian Fund.

Steven Ross Sainfield Press, Board Member (Date of birth 03 March 1955).
Has been appointed as Board member of HSBC Bank Armenia CJSC on 10 June 2009. Graduated from Institute of Chartered Accountants in England and Wales. Has been a partner Stoy Hayward, Chartered Accountants, London from 1976 to 1987. Currently is a Proprietor of Press Stanton Associates, London.

Ranjit Gokarn, Board Member (Date of birth 24 January, 1967).
Has been appointed as Board member of HSBC Bank Armenia CJSC on 12 January 2010. Graduated from the Sydenham College of Commerce and Indian Institute of Management. Has occupied various managerial positions in HSBC Group member companies. Currently holds the position of Senior Executive in HSBC Bank plc.

Alan Beattie, Board Member (Date of birth 22 October, 1964).
Has been appointed as Board member of HSBC Bank Armenia CJSC on 28 April 2011. Graduated from the University of Edinburgh and Heriott-Watt University located in the United Kingdom. Has occupied various managerial positions in HSBC Group member companies. Currently holds the position of Deputy CEO Continental Europe in HSBC Bank plc.

Mark Emmerson, Board Member (Date of birth 23 March, 1966).
Has been appointed as Board member of HSBC Bank Armenia CJSC on 28 April 2011. Graduated from the Loughborough University and the Associate of Chartered Institute of Bankers located in the United Kingdom. Has occupied various managerial positions in HSBC Group member companies. Currently holds the position of Head of Trade and Supply Chain - Europe in HSBC Bank plc.

Ara Alexanian, Board Member (Date of birth – 3 June 1957)
Doctor of Physico-Mathematical Sciences. Board member of H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c since 1995 and HSBC Bank Georgia cjsc since 2007. Head of Sub-Faculty at Yerevan State University. Served as General Director of Armimpexbank cjsc from 18 June 2003 to 30 September 2007.

Astrid Clifford, Chief Executive Officer (Date of birth 20 June, 1966)
Has been appointed as Chief Executive Officer of H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c from 30 January 2010 and has been registered to that position by the RA Central Bank on 01 June 2010. Graduated from Southampton University and London School of Economics. Has occupied various managerial positions in HSBC Group member companies.

Guy Lewis, Board Member (Date of birth 20 April 1976)
Has been appointed as Board member of HSBC Bank Armenia CJSC on 05 August 2009. Graduated from University of Bristol. Currently is studying at University of Liverpool (Distance Learning). Has been a Senior Vice-President, Marketing and Business Development at HSBC Bank Ltd, Mauritius from 2006 to 2008. Currently is the Chief Executive Officer of HSBC Georgia JSC.

Mkrtich Loretsyan, Head of Internal Audit (Date of birth - 1 November 1970)
Has been employed in H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c since 1998. Completed the full course of study at Moscow State Technical University after Bauman in 1993. Before employment with H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c worked in the Defence Ministry of Armenia (1993-1998). Started employment with H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c as a Financial Control Department specialist, later has been promoted to the position of Financial Control Supervisor (2003-2006). According to H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c board's decision held the position of Head of Internal Audit starting from 13 July 2006.

Irina Seylanyan, Deputy Chief Executive Officer/Head of Markets (Date of Birth 3 February, 1975)
Has been employed in H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c since 1997. Completed the full course of studies at Yerevan State Engineering University in 1996. During the period of 2001 - 2007 has studied in ACCA (Association of Chartered Certified Accountants) and was admitted as an ACCA member. Before employment with HSBC worked in several local companies as a computer programmer. Started employment with HSBC as a Financial Control Clerk (1997-1999) and was later promoted to the position of Financial Control Senior Clerk (1999-2000) , Financial Control Supervisor (2000-2001), Manager Finance (2001-2002), Head of Audit (2002-2006), Head of Markets (2006-to present). On June 19, 2007 was appointed to the position of Deputy Chief Executive Officer of HSBC Bank Armenia and currently acts in that capacity.

Vardan Grkikyan, (Date of Birth – 07 April 1968), Deputy Chief Executive Officer/Chief Risk Officer
Has been employed in H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c since 1995. Graduated from Yerevan State Engineering University in 1992 and from American University of Armenia in 1994. Held the following positions in H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c - manager of customer service division, manager of commercial banking department, head of commercial banking department. From July 24, 2009 has been appointed to the position of Deputy Chief Executive Officer/Chief Risk Officer of H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c.

Gevorg Tarumyan, Chief Financial Officer (Date of birth – 23 May 1969)
Has been employed by HSBC Bank Armenia CJSC as a Chief Financial Officer since April 2008. Completed the full course of study at Yerevan State Institute of Economy on 1992, in 2004 completed summer school at the London School of Economics and is currently studying towards ACCA qualification. Started his career in the banking sector in 1994 in the Supervision Department of the Central Bank of Armenia, where occupied various managerial positions. During that period Gevorg Tarumyan was also in charge of coordination of the banking supervision for Armenia within the project implemented by the Basel Committee in the Middle Asia and Caucasus. In 1999 he moved to “Armimpexbank “ CJSC as a Financial Director and in February 2006 was appointed as a Deputy Chief Executive Officer of the same bank. In April 2007 moved to “VTB Bank (Armenia)” CJSC as a Deputy of General Director-Head of Directorate, Financial Director. Gevorg Tarumyan held various lectures on financial analysis and risk management for the employees of banks and financial institutions. He is an author and co-author of number of textbooks and publications on banking, financial analysis and risk management.

Astghik Drambyan, Chief Accountant (Date of Birth15 April, 1978)
Has joined HSBC Bank Armenia in 1998. Completed the full course of study at Yerevan State University of Economy in 1999. During the period of 2002-2006 has studied in ACCA (Association of Chartered Certified Accountants) and has been admitted as an ACCA member. Started her career with H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c as a Financial Control Clerk (1998-2001) and was later promoted to the position of Financial Control Senior Clerk/Analyst (2001-2002), Financial Control Manager Finance (2002-2008). On June 19, 2008 has been appointed to the position of Chief Accountant of HSBC Bank Armenia cjsc.
